Well you need to be fairly obsessed with a website and have the time to devote to it . What I have done is to take a look at the session of each user and ask what browser they are using. If it's mobile then they are presented with a different template, or way of displaying the info from the database. From there it's exactly the same as the rest of the site, it just looks different and is optimised for a small window. It makes it a reasonably easy task when the whole site is written in server side code.
